CISC (Complex Instruction Set Computer) servers are a category of enterprise hardware defined by their processor architecture, which utilizes a rich, comprehensive set of instructions. These servers are designed to handle complex operations with single instructions, which can be advantageous for specific enterprise workloads requiring high computational power. This architecture is foundational to the x86 ecosystem, powering a vast majority of on-premise and cloud data centers worldwide. While facing competition from RISC-based and ARM architectures, CISC servers remain a dominant force in enterprise computing, particularly for applications demanding robust single-threaded performance and broad software compatibility.

Despite the market's maturity and the ongoing transition to cloud-native and ARM-based solutions, steady demand from key verticals like telecommunications, financial services, and government is sustaining growth. The need for data processing in hybrid cloud environments and for legacy applications that are deeply embedded in x86 architecture continues to drive replacements and upgrades. However, market expansion is tempered by the increasing adoption of energy-efficient and hyperscale-optimized server designs. Leading manufacturers like Dell Technologies and Hewlett Packard Enterprise (HPE) continue to innovate within this space, focusing on integrating advanced management features and improving performance-per-watt to meet evolving data center demands.

COMPETITIVE LANDSCAPE

Key Industry Players

Strategic Portfolio Expansion and Regional Penetration Drive Market Competition

The competitive landscape of the global CISC server market is highly consolidated, dominated by a handful of established multinational corporations with extensive supply chains and deep-rooted customer relationships. This concentration is driven by the significant capital investment required for R&D, manufacturing, and global sales channels. Dell Technologies Inc. and Hewlett Packard Enterprise (HPE) are universally recognized as the market leaders, consistently holding the top revenue and shipment shares. Their dominance is attributed to comprehensive product portfolios spanning from entry-level tower servers to high-density rack and blade systems, coupled with strong direct sales forces and extensive partner ecosystems across North America and Europe.

While the top tier is firmly held by U.S.-based giants, the competitive dynamics are intensely shaped by aggressive competition from Asia-Pacific. Inspur (now Inspur Electronic Information Industry Co., Ltd.) and Lenovo have captured substantial market share, particularly in the Asia region and increasingly in international markets. Their growth is fueled by competitive pricing, government-backed initiatives in their home markets, and rapid innovation cycles. For instance, these companies have been quick to integrate the latest Intel and AMD CISC processors into their systems to cater to the burgeoning demand for data center and cloud infrastructure.

Furthermore, the competitive environment is characterized by continuous strategic maneuvering. Companies are not just selling hardware but integrated solutions, including software-defined infrastructure and management tools. Cisco Systems, with its Unified Computing System (UCS), competes directly by offering a tightly integrated server-networking-storage stack, appealing to enterprises seeking simplified data center management. Meanwhile, players like Huawei and H3C, despite facing geopolitical headwinds in certain Western markets, maintain formidable positions in Asia, the Middle East, and Africa through strong local partnerships and custom solutions for telecommunications and government sectors.

Looking ahead, competition is expected to intensify around edge computing and hybrid cloud deployments. All major players are launching optimized CISC server platforms designed for edge environments, which require ruggedness and compact form factors. Additionally, niche specialists like Super Micro Computer, Inc. (SuperMicro) continue to hold significant sway by offering highly customizable, building-block-style servers favored by large-scale data center operators and cloud service providers. Their focus on open standards and rapid time-to-market for new technologies ensures they remain critical players in the ecosystem. The ongoing race for energy efficiency and sustainability is also becoming a key competitive differentiator, pushing all manufacturers to innovate in cooling technologies and power management.

Regional Analysis: CISC Server Market

North America

The North American market, led by the United States, is a mature yet highly dynamic segment for CISC servers, characterized by a strong emphasis on technological refresh cycles, cloud integration, and enterprise digital transformation. The U.S. market, estimated at a significant multi-billion dollar valuation in 2025, is driven by substantial investments in data center infrastructure, particularly from hyperscalers and large enterprises. Key drivers include the ongoing migration to hybrid and multi-cloud environments, which necessitates robust, general-purpose CISC servers for a wide range of workloads from traditional databases to virtualized environments. Furthermore, government initiatives and defense spending contribute to steady demand, especially for secure and compliant systems. However, the region also faces intense competition from alternative architectures like ARM-based servers in specific workloads, pushing incumbent vendors like Dell and HPE to innovate continuously in performance-per-watt and total cost of ownership. The focus is on high-density rack and blade configurations to optimize data center space and power efficiency, with sustainability becoming an increasingly important procurement criterion.

Europe

Europe presents a stable market for CISC servers, underpinned by stringent data sovereignty regulations like GDPR and a strong industrial base. Demand is fueled by the digitalization of traditional industries such as automotive, manufacturing, and finance, which rely on the proven reliability and extensive software ecosystem of CISC-based systems for core business operations. Countries like Germany, the UK, and France are major contributors, with significant spending on enterprise IT infrastructure. The European market is also seeing growth driven by investments in edge computing, where compact and robust tower and ruggedized rack servers are deployed for latency-sensitive applications in smart factories and telecommunications. A key trend is the push towards energy-efficient computing, aligned with the EU's Green Deal, prompting server manufacturers to highlight power management features and sustainable design. While economic headwinds can temporarily dampen capital expenditure, the foundational need for enterprise computing and ongoing cloud adoption provides a resilient demand floor for CISC servers across the region.

Asia-Pacific

Asia-Pacific is the largest and fastest-growing regional market for CISC servers, dominated by China's massive internet, telecommunications, and public sector demand. China's market is projected to reach a multi-billion dollar scale by 2034, driven by national strategies in cloud computing, artificial intelligence, and 5G network rollout, which all require extensive backend server infrastructure. Local champions like Inspur, Lenovo, and Huawei hold substantial market share, competing fiercely with global giants. Beyond China, countries like Japan, South Korea, and India are significant markets. Japan maintains demand for high-reliability systems in finance and manufacturing, while India's growth is propelled by its rapidly expanding digital economy, data localization policies, and investments from both domestic and global cloud service providers. The region exhibits a dual demand pattern: cost-sensitive, high-volume procurement for large-scale data center builds and a simultaneous demand for premium, high-performance systems for mission-critical applications. This makes Asia-Pacific a complex but essential battlefield for all major server vendors.

South America

The South American CISC server market is emerging and characterized by moderate growth potential tempered by economic and political volatility. Brazil and Argentina are the primary markets, where demand is driven by the gradual modernization of banking systems, telecommunications networks, and government IT infrastructure. The adoption is often focused on essential upgrades and replacement cycles rather than expansive new deployments. Challenges include currency fluctuations, which affect import costs for hardware, and limited IT budgets compared to more developed regions. Consequently, there is a pronounced preference for value-oriented tower and standard rack servers that balance performance with affordability. While cloud adoption is growing, it also creates competition for on-premises server sales. Nonetheless, opportunities exist in specific verticals like natural resource industries and for vendors that can offer strong local support and financing options, helping to navigate the region's unique macroeconomic landscape.

Middle East & Africa

The Middle East & Africa region represents an emerging market with long-term strategic growth prospects, particularly in the Gulf Cooperation Council (GCC) nations and select African economies like South Africa. Growth is fueled by national visions for economic diversification, such as Saudi Arabia's Vision 2030 and the UAE's digital government initiatives, which involve large-scale investments in smart city projects, government cloud platforms, and financial technology. These projects generate demand for modern data center infrastructure, including CISC servers. The region shows a strong preference for high-end, reliable rack and blade servers from established global brands, with a focus on vendor reputation and service quality. In Africa, growth is more nascent and fragmented, driven by mobile telecommunications expansion and the gradual development of digital services. Across the region, challenges include the need for robust cooling solutions due to harsh climates, developing local technical expertise, and navigating complex import regulations. However, the underlying trend of digital infrastructure build-out positions MEA as a region of increasing importance for server vendors.
